A Brief Overview of Viagra
First off, let’s recap what exactly Viagra is for the uninitiated. Viagra, aka sildenafil, is a medication used to treat erectile dysfunction (ED). As a phosphodiesterase type 5 (PDE5) inhibitor, it works by increasing blood flow to the penis, allowing for an erection in response to sexual stimulation. The Prescription Dilemma
In most countries, Viagra is classified as a prescription medication. That means you typically need to have a discussion with your healthcare provider, who will assess if it’s the right option for you based on your health and medical history. The Gray Areas of Buying Viagra Online
Let’s talk about the internet, the wild west of shopping! Many websites claim you can buy Viagra no prescription needed. Now, I get it—a few clicks, enter some basic info, and boom, the promise of ease and discretion. But here’s the kicker: while there are some reputable online pharmacies that operate legally and safely, many others are not. This raises several red flags.
-
Quality Control: Medications bought without a prescription often come from questionable sources. The FDA warns that drugs purchased outside regulated environments can be counterfeit, contaminated, or completely different from what they are marketed to be.
-
Health Risks: Consider this scenario: you order Viagra online without a prescription. You receive it, pop a pill, and—oh no! You have an adverse reaction. Without proper guidance on whether this medication is right for you, you could be putting your health on the line.
- Legal Issues: Depending on your location, buying Viagra without a prescription can lead to legal issues. In some regions, it may be completely illegal to purchase medications without a prescription, leading to potential fines or other consequences. The Rise of Telemedicine
With advancements in technology, telemedicine has emerged as a viable alternative for those looking to source their medications without the awkward face-to-face chat. You can now consult with healthcare professionals online, who can assess your needs and provide prescriptions more discreetly.
